
In the later sections of this book, we will discuss integration with build tools, unit testing frameworks, debugger, profiling, version control system, and database. This book requires that the readers have some preliminary knowledge of the software development process, along with Java programming language. Beginners will get a fair understanding of IntelliJ and its functioning, and others will be able to take their knowledge on this subject to the next level. This book is targeted at first-time learners, as well as moderate users of IntelliJ. This book starts with a basic introduction and slowly dives deep into the advanced features. This feature-rich IDE enables rapid development and helps in improving code quality. It was developed and is maintained by JetBrains, and is available in the community and ultimate edition. It is assumed that the required tools are installed and configured on the system and the reader is familiar with those tools.ĭescription: IntelliJ IDEA (hereafter referred to as IntelliJ) is one of the most powerful and popular Integrated Development Environments (IDE) for Java. This book requires that the readers have some preliminary knowledge of the software development process, along with the Java programming language.



Description: ** We prefer you to this book in the series number-wise.** IntelliJ IDEA (hereafter referred to as IntelliJ) is one of the most powerful and popular Integrated Development Environments (IDE) for Java.
